A well appointed ground floor retirement flat with the advantage of french windows opening onto a patio with communal gardens beyond. The Maltings is a popular retirement development close to Westgate and a short distance from the city centre with all of its facilities.

Location - The property stands in this very convenient position off Westgate, a short walk from the Cathedral and the centre of Chichester with all of its facilities including shops, restaurants, Pallant House Gallery, Chichester Festival Theatre and the mainline railway station with services to London Victoria. It is approximately six miles to the coast and the sandy beaches at Wittering, also close by is the open countryside around The Downs with sporting and other events at Goodwood

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2
